pmu_init() register its event checking the pm_event::supported() handler. For INST_RETIRED, the event is only registered and the bit enabled in the PMU Common Event Identification register when icount is enabled as ICOUNT_PRECISE.
Assert the pm_event::get_count() and pm_event::ns_per_count() handler will only be called under this icount mode.
